AdvoCare helps fuel Storm’s record-breaking winning streak
Sioux Falls Storm wins 31st consecutive game
The Sioux Falls Storm of the United Indoor Football Association won their 31st consecutive game on Saturday, with a pro football record-breaking 56-20 victory over the Ohio Valley Greyhounds.
